Summary:
This book provides policy makers with the keys to navigating complicated environmental issues and stakeholder negotiations. It covers theories in environmental policy making and stakeholder management, an overview of the concepts of failed versus successful process and policy, and practical guidelines and tools for the practitioner. The book also includes a number of environmental case studies which fully engage the concept of collaboration.
